Remote Senior Agricultural Scientist - Crop Optimization
Our client, a global leader in agricultural innovation, is seeking a highly skilled and motivated Remote Senior Agricultural Scientist specializing in Crop Optimization. This fully remote position offers the unique opportunity to contribute to cutting-edge research and development from anywhere in the world, with a focus on enhancing crop yields and sustainability. The ideal candidate will possess a Ph.D. in Agronomy, Plant Science, or a closely related field, coupled with extensive experience in advanced crop modeling, data analysis, and field trial design. You will be instrumental in developing and validating innovative strategies for optimizing crop performance across diverse geographical and climatic conditions. Key Responsibilities: Lead research initiatives focused on identifying and implementing advanced techniques for crop yield improvement and resource efficiency. Develop, calibrate, and validate sophisticated crop simulation models using statistical software and programming languages (e.g., R, Python). Design and manage large-scale field experiments to test hypotheses and gather empirical data on crop responses to various agronomic practices and environmental factors. Analyze complex datasets from field trials, remote sensing, and genomic information to derive actionable insights and recommendations. Collaborate with cross-functional teams, including geneticists, soil scientists, and agronomists, to integrate findings into breeding programs and farm management recommendations. Author high-impact scientific publications for peer-reviewed journals and present research findings at international conferences. Mentor junior scientists and research assistants involved in crop optimization projects. Stay abreast of the latest advancements in agricultural science, technology, and relevant policy changes. Contribute to the strategic direction of the company's R&D efforts in sustainable agriculture. Develop and maintain strong relationships with external research institutions and industry partners. Required Qualifications: Ph.D. in Agronomy, Plant Science, Agricultural Science, or a related discipline. A minimum of 7 years of post-doctoral research experience focused on crop physiology, modeling, and agronomy. Demonstrated expertise in developing and applying crop simulation models (e.g., APSIM, DSSAT, CropSyst). Proficiency in statistical analysis and data visualization tools (e.g., R, Python, SAS, SPSS). Experience with designing and interpreting field experiments, including statistical analysis of agronomic data. Familiarity with remote sensing technologies and GIS applications in agriculture. Excellent scientific writing and oral communication skills, with a strong publication record. Ability to work independently and collaboratively in a remote team environment. Strong project management skills, with the ability to manage multiple research projects simultaneously. Passion for sustainable agriculture and a commitment to scientific rigor.
